PHILADELPHIA, PA — Motorists in South Philadelphia should prepare for a weeklong closure on Ritner Street as PennDOT crews perform overhead bridge repairs on Interstate 95.
At a Glance
- Roads Affected: Ritner Street, Swanson Street, Wolf Street, Shunk Street, Front Street
- Dates: Monday, June 8, through Friday, June 12
- Times: 24 hours a day
- Reason: Overhead bridge repair on I-95
PennDOT said Ritner Street will be closed around the clock between Swanson Street and Front Street from Monday, June 8, through Friday, June 12.
During the closure, motorists will be directed to use either Swanson Street, Wolf Street, and Front Street or Swanson Street, Shunk Street, and Front Street to travel around the work zone and reconnect with Ritner Street.
Local access for residents and businesses will remain available throughout the project.
Drivers traveling through the area should expect changing traffic patterns and possible delays along the detour routes. Plan extra time and consider alternate routes, particularly during peak travel periods.
The closure is part of a $60.4 million PennDOT program to perform high-priority repairs on interstate bridges throughout the Philadelphia region. Work includes repairs to bridge decks, structural steel, concrete components, expansion joints, bearings, guiderails, sign supports, and roadway lighting upgrades.
PennDOT said the broader effort is intended to preserve the safety, reliability, and long-term functionality of critical transportation corridors across the region.
All scheduled work is weather dependent.
